@import url(https://fonts.googleapis.com/css2?family=Lato&display=swap);*{font-family:Lato,sans-serif}.createItem,.itemView,.login,.logout,.resetPassword{height:90vh;padding-top:60px}.admin,.createItem,.itemView,.login,.logout,.resetPassword{align-items:center;display:grid;font-size:3rem;justify-content:center}.admin{height:30vh;padding-top:90px}header{background-color:#fff;box-shadow:0 2px 5px #0000001a;height:80px;top:0;width:100%}footer,header{align-items:center;display:flex;justify-content:center;left:0;position:fixed;z-index:1000}footer{background-color:#00519c;bottom:0;color:grey;font-size:calc(5px + 1vmin);height:50px;right:0}main{min-height:calc(100vh - 110px);overflow-y:auto;padding-bottom:50px;padding-top:60px}.App{left:15%;right:15%}.App,.App-logo{position:absolute}.App-logo{display:flex;flex-direction:column;margin-top:10px;max-height:60px;top:0}h1{color:#780a0a;font-weight:bolder}h1,p{margin-left:20px}p{color:#a9a9a9}.ucase{text-transform:uppercase}.modalBox{align-items:center;border-radius:20px;display:flex;flex-direction:column;justify-content:center;left:50%;margin:0 auto;padding:2em;position:absolute;top:75%;transform:translate(-50%,-50%);width:48%}.drag,.heading{color:#191442;font-weight:600}.drag{cursor:pointer;margin-bottom:.5em;margin-top:1em}.drag .browse{color:#fe8d57;display:inline-block}.file-label{cursor:pointer}.info,.instruction{color:#6f6c78}.info{font-size:12px}.btn-container{border:.1px solid;border-radius:5px;display:flex}.uploadBox{align-items:center;border:2px dashed #7866e3;border-radius:10px;display:flex;flex-direction:column;justify-content:center;padding:2em;text-align:center}.upload-icon{color:#7866e3;font-size:2em}.fileIcon{display:none}.filename{font-size:12px}.warningText{color:red;font-size:14px}.Prebooking{background-color:#e8d5b7}.Booked{background-color:#ffffbf}.Out{background-color:#d1ffbd}.Returned{background-color:#ffdbbb}.ReturnInspection{background-color:#c5b4e3}.Invoiced{background-color:#add8e6}*{box-sizing:border-box;margin:0;padding:0}.wb-root{background:#0d1117;color:#e6edf3;display:grid;font-family:Segoe UI,Arial,sans-serif;grid-template-rows:56px 120px 1fr 220px;height:100vh;overflow:hidden;width:100vw}.wb-header{align-items:center;background:#161b22;border-bottom:2px solid #21262d;display:flex;justify-content:space-between;padding:0 28px}.wb-header h1{color:#58a6ff;font-size:22px;font-weight:700;letter-spacing:1px;text-transform:uppercase}.wb-header-right{color:#8b949e;font-size:13px;gap:24px}.wb-header-right,.wb-interval{align-items:center;display:flex}.wb-interval{gap:8px}.wb-interval input{background:#21262d;border:1px solid #30363d;border-radius:4px;color:#e6edf3;font-size:13px;padding:3px 6px;text-align:center;width:52px}.wb-last-updated{color:#3fb950}.wb-pipeline{align-items:stretch;background:#161b22;border-bottom:2px solid #21262d;display:flex;gap:10px;padding:12px 28px}.wb-status-card{align-items:center;border-radius:8px;cursor:default;display:flex;flex:1 1;flex-direction:column;justify-content:center;padding:8px 4px}.wb-status-card .wb-status-count{font-size:42px;font-weight:800;line-height:1}.wb-status-card .wb-status-name{font-size:11px;font-weight:600;letter-spacing:.8px;margin-top:4px;opacity:.85;text-transform:uppercase}.wb-card-Prebooking{background:#5a4a3a;color:#e8d5b7}.wb-card-Booked{background:#5a5a00;color:#ffffbf}.wb-card-Out{background:#1a4a1a;color:#d1ffbd}.wb-card-ReturnInspection{background:#3a2a5a;color:#c5b4e3}.wb-card-Returned{background:#5a3a1a;color:#ffdbbb}.wb-card-Invoiced{background:#1a3a5a;color:#add8e6}.wb-main{grid-gap:0;display:grid;gap:0;grid-template-columns:60% 40%;overflow:hidden}.wb-panel{display:flex;flex-direction:column;overflow:hidden;padding:14px 20px}.wb-panel+.wb-panel{border-left:2px solid #21262d}.wb-panel-title{color:#8b949e;flex-shrink:0;font-size:13px;font-weight:700;letter-spacing:1px;margin-bottom:10px;text-transform:uppercase}.wb-panel-title span{font-size:18px;font-weight:800;margin-left:8px}.wb-panel-title.overdue-title,.wb-panel-title.overdue-title span{color:#f85149}.wb-table-wrap{flex:1 1;overflow-y:auto}.wb-table{border-collapse:collapse;font-size:14px;width:100%}.wb-table thead tr{background:#21262d;position:-webkit-sticky;position:sticky;top:0;z-index:1}.wb-table th{color:#8b949e;font-size:11px;font-weight:600;letter-spacing:.5px;padding:7px 10px;text-align:left;text-transform:uppercase}.wb-table td{border-bottom:1px solid #21262d;color:#e6edf3;padding:7px 10px}.wb-table tbody tr:hover{background:#1c2128}.wb-row-overdue td{color:#f85149!important;font-weight:600}.wb-row-overdue td:last-child{color:#f85149}.wb-upcoming{background:#161b22;border-top:2px solid #21262d;display:flex;flex-direction:column;overflow:hidden;padding:12px 20px}.wb-upcoming .wb-panel-title{margin-bottom:8px}.wb-upcoming .wb-table-wrap{flex:1 1;overflow-y:auto}.wb-badge{border-radius:10px;display:inline-block;font-size:11px;font-weight:700;padding:1px 7px}.wb-badge-Prebooking{background:#5a4a3a;color:#e8d5b7}.wb-badge-Booked{background:#5a5a00;color:#ffffbf}.wb-table-wrap::-webkit-scrollbar{width:6px}.wb-table-wrap::-webkit-scrollbar-track{background:#0000}.wb-table-wrap::-webkit-scrollbar-thumb{background:#30363d;border-radius:3px}.navbar{align-items:center;background-color:#00519c;display:inline-flex;height:80px;justify-content:flex-start;width:50%}.menu-bars{background:none;color:#fff;font-size:2rem;margin-left:2rem}.nav-menu{background-color:#060b26;display:flex;height:100vh;justify-content:center;left:-100%;position:fixed;top:0;transition:.85s;width:250px;z-index:9999}.nav-menu.active{left:0;transition:.35s}.nav-text{height:60px;justify-content:flex-start;list-style:none;padding:8px 0 8px 16px}.nav-text,.nav-text a{align-items:center;display:flex}.nav-text a{border-radius:4px;color:#f5f5f5;font-size:18px;height:100%;padding:0 16px;text-decoration:none;width:95%}.nav-text a:hover{background-color:#1a83ff}.nav-menu-items{width:100%}.navbar-toggle{align-items:center;background-color:#060b26;display:flex;height:80px;justify-content:flex-start;width:100%}span{margin-left:16px}.userbar{align-items:center;background-color:#00519c;display:inline-flex;height:80px;justify-content:flex-end;width:50%}.userMenu-bars{background:none;color:#fff;font-size:2rem;margin-right:2rem}.user-menu{background-color:#060b26;display:flex;height:37vh;justify-content:center;position:fixed;right:0;top:-100%;transition:.85s;width:250px;z-index:9999}.user-menu.active{right:0;top:0;transition:.35s}.user-text{height:60px;justify-content:flex-end;list-style:none;padding:8px 0 8px 16px}.user-text,.user-text a{align-items:center;display:flex}.user-text a{border-radius:4px;color:#f5f5f5;font-size:18px;height:100%;padding:0 16px;text-decoration:none;width:95%}.user-text-small{align-items:center;display:flex;height:60px;justify-content:flex-end;list-style:none;padding:8px 0 8px 16px}.user-text-small a{align-items:center;border-radius:4px;color:#f5f5f5;display:flex;font-size:12px;height:100%;padding:0 16px;text-decoration:none;width:95%}.user-text a:hover{background-color:#1a83ff}.user-menu-items{width:100%}.userbar-toggle{align-items:center;background-color:#060b26;display:flex;height:80px;justify-content:flex-end;width:100%}span{margin-right:16px}
/*# sourceMappingURL=main.96b34f42.css.map*/